上一篇
html网站源代码
- 行业动态
- 2025-04-27
- 3
HTML网站源代码由HTML标签、文本内容及属性构成,定义网页结构与样式,包含(元数据)和)两大部分,通过、等标签组织内容,CSS样式可内联或链接外部文件,JavaScript实现交互逻辑
基础结构
HTML 网站由多个层级的标签构成,核心结构如下:
代码片段 | 功能说明 |
---|---|
<!DOCTYPE html> | 声明文档类型为 HTML5 |
<html> | 根标签,包裹所有内容 |
<head> | 包含元数据(如标题、字符集、样式表等) |
<meta charset="UTF-8"> | 定义字符编码,避免乱码 |
<body> | 网页主体内容区域 |
</html> | 闭合根标签 |
头部常用标签
作用 | 示例 | |
---|---|---|
<link rel="stylesheet" href="style.css"> | 引入外部 CSS 文件 | 加载样式表 |
<meta name="viewport" content="width=device-width, initial-scale=1.0"> | 适配移动设备屏幕 | 响应式设计支持 |
<script src="script.js"></script> | 引入外部 JavaScript 文件 | 添加交互功能 |
结构
功能 | 示例 | |
---|---|---|
<h1>~<h6> | 标题层级(<h1> 为最高级别) | <h1>网站主标题</h1> |
<p> | 段落文本 | <p>这是一个段落。</p> |
<a href="https://example.com"> | 超链接 | 点击跳转到指定 URL |
<img src="image.jpg" alt="描述"> | 图片 | 显示图像并添加替代文本 |
<ul>/<ol> | 无序/有序列表 | 配合 <li> 使用 |
<table> | 表格 | 含 <tr> (行)、<td> (单元格) |
常见问题与解答
问题1:为什么网页显示乱码?
答:可能未声明字符编码,需在 <head>
中添加 <meta charset="UTF-8">
,确保浏览器正确解析中文或其他特殊字符。
问题2:链接点击后无法跳转怎么办?
答:检查 <a>
标签的 href
属性是否正确,确保 URL 完整(如 https://